MEEKER I The Meeker Lions Club presented awards at its annual Christmas party in early December. Mark Rogers and Bill Jordan received awards for their outstanding service to the club and Ken Coffin was recognized as “Lion of the Year” for 2014.

Local CPW officer aids investigation
RBC I Colorado Parks and Wildlife and the Moffat County District Attorney’s Office have completed an investigation and prosecution of Craig resident Justin McCurdy, 28, for a variety of wildlife offenses. CNCC Craig campus names new vice president
RBC I Janell Oberlander from Rapid City, S.D., has officially accepted the position of CNCC Craig Campus vice president. She accepted the position when she spoke to CNCC President Russell George on Wednesday.
